Technically the season has started. However, DraftKings is still taking bets on season stats leaders because it was only a couple of teams (featuring significant players for sure) that got the season going in Seoul.  Last year, Atlanta OF Ronald Acuna Jr. scored an amazing 149 runs, running away with the category. To put that in context, nobody had broken 140 since A-Rod back in 2007 (143), and the last player to have more runs was Jeff Bagwell back in 2000. Scoring mega runs usually comes from a combination of getting on base mixed with some power. Sometimes you gotta drive yourself in, right?
